12 tips for air-energy water heater heat pump maintenance
Aug 12, 2024
1. Make sure the water tank is full of water when the unit is used for the first time.
2. All safety protection devices in the unit are set before leaving the factory and after installation by the staff. Users should not disassemble or adjust all devices in the unit by themselves.
3. When the air-energy water heater unit is working, make sure that the water tank inlet pipe valve is in the open position, and avoid stacking debris around the unit to cause blockage of the inlet and outlet, affecting the normal use of the unit. The surrounding area of the unit should be kept clean and dry with good ventilation.
4. When the actual outlet water temperature of the air-energy water heater is different from the value displayed on the unit control panel, check whether the temperature sensing device has poor contact.
5. Frequently check whether the water tank safety valve, water system water replenishment, exhaust device, and liquid level controller are operating normally, check whether the joints of the water pipe are leaking, and regularly check whether the wiring of the unit power supply and electrical system is firm and whether the electrical components are abnormal. If there is any abnormality, it should be repaired or replaced in time to avoid affecting the reliability of the unit's operation.
6. The water filter should be cleaned regularly to avoid damage to the main unit due to dirty filter clogging and to ensure clean water quality in the system.
7. Check the electrical system and power supply wiring of the unit regularly to see if they are firm. If there is any abnormality, it should be handled in time.
8. The safety valve should be checked regularly every six months to ensure that the safety valve can drain water smoothly. If it cannot drain water, contact the after-sales service immediately.
9. The main unit should be cleaned after one or two years of use. It is recommended to use hot phosphoric acid liquid to clean the condenser with a concentration of about 15%. Start the main unit's own circulating water pump for cleaning. Finally, clean it several times with tap water. It is strictly forbidden to use corrosive cleaning fluid to clean the condenser.
10. The water tank needs to be descaled after a period of use (usually 3 months, depending on the local water quality) (in areas with high water hardness, silicon phosphorus crystals can also be used for water softening treatment), and the drain valve is opened until clean water flows out.
11. When the unit has not used for a long time, the water in the unit system should be drained and the power should be cut off. Before the next operation, the unit system should be fully checked.
12. When a major fault occurs in the unit, the user should not handle it by himself but should report it to the after-sales service in time and inform the problem so that it can be solved in time.
